Contributing# This part of the documentation is for developers and contributors. Adding Learners Where does my new learner go? What does a learner implement? How do I test my new learner? How do I document my new learner? How to debug failed GitHub Actions? Adding Tests PyTest Doctest Documentation Docstrings Notebooks Manual Documentation Version Control Commit Messages Breaking Changes Updating CapyMOA’s moa.jar version Refreshing the moa.jar Changing Project MOA Version